Her time has become even more valuable now that she has become the co-founder of an organic baby food company called Once Upon A Farm.

She uses her family’s old farm in Oklahoma to supply some of the fruit and vegetables to the business.

With all the time she puts into the farm and working the land, Garner has truly earned the nickname “Farmer Jen.”

The farm, near the small town of Locust Grove in northeastern Oklahoma, has been in her family for almost a century.

Garner’s grandparents bought the 50-acre plot of land, complete with a two-room house with no electricity, running water and no indoor plumbing, for $700 in 1936, according to Southern life.

Her maternal grandparents added another 35 acres to the farm and grew a variety of fruits and vegetables, including lettuce, beets, green beans, tomatoes, English peas, cucumbers, onions and new potatoes.

Launched in 2015, Cassandra Curtis co-founded Once Upon A Farm with Ari Raz “to create more nutritious, convenient and delicious baby food options for her daughter that were not available in her local supermarket,” according to the company website.

After creating her own recipes and selling the first cold-pressed baby food at retail, she joined forces with industry legend and former Annie’s CEO John Forake and Garner.

Eight years later, Once Upon A Farm is proud to be “sold in more than 13,000 stores nationwide, with a growing product portfolio of organic, farm-fresh snacks and meals for babies and big kids.”
